ChatGPT is a powerful language model developed by OpenAI. It is based on the GPT (Generative Pre-training Transformer) architecture, which is a transformer-based neural network designed for natural language processing tasks. ChatGPT is trained on a massive dataset of text from the internet, making it highly capable of understanding and generating human-like text.
One of the key features of ChatGPT is its ability to generate text that is indistinguishable from text written by a human. This is known as “text generation” and it is achieved through a process called “pre-training”. During pre-training, the model is exposed to a large corpus of text and learns to predict the next word in a sequence based on the previous words. This enables the model to understand the structure and meaning of language, allowing it to generate text that is coherent and grammatically correct.
ChatGPT can be fine-tuned to perform a variety of natural language processing tasks, such as language translation, text summarization, and question answering. This is possible because the model has been trained on a diverse range of text and has a deep understanding of the nuances of language.
One of the most popular use cases for ChatGPT is in chatbot development. The model can be fine-tuned to understand the context of a conversation and generate appropriate responses. This makes it possible to create chatbots that can carry on a conversation in a natural and engaging way. The model is also able to understand and respond to different languages, making it possible to create multilingual chatbots.
Another application of ChatGPT is in content creation. The model can be used to generate text for a variety of purposes, such as writing news articles, blog posts, and even creative fiction. This has the potential to save time and resources for content creators, as well as open up new possibilities for content generation.
One of the main advantages of ChatGPT is its ability to understand and respond to unstructured data. This makes it suitable for a wide range of applications, from chatbot development to content creation. The model is also highly customizable, allowing developers to fine-tune it to suit their specific needs.
However, it is worth noting that there are also potential drawbacks to using a model like ChatGPT. One concern is that the model may perpetuate biases present in the data it was trained on. Additionally, it may generate text that is not entirely original and may closely resemble existing text. There is also a risk that the model could be used to generate fake or misleading content.
To mitigate these risks, it is important to be transparent about the limitations of the model and to use it responsibly. It is also important to continually monitor and update the model to ensure that it is performing as expected and that any biases are addressed.
In conclusion, ChatGPT is a powerful language model that has the potential to revolutionize natural language processing and content creation. It is capable of generating human-like text and can be fine-tuned to perform a variety of tasks. However, it is important to use the model responsibly and to be aware of its limitations. By using ChatGPT in a thoughtful and ethical way, we can unlock its full potential and create new possibilities for natural language processing and content creation.